Ctenochromis pectoralis Pfeffer, 1893 View in CoL

Figs 6a–d View Fig , 7a–f View Fig , 8a–b View Fig

Tilapia pectoralis View in CoL – Boulenger 1899: 130.

Haplochromis pectoralis View in CoL – Regan 1922a: 685. — Jordan 1923: 219. — van Oijen et al. 1991: 161.

non Harpagochromis pectoralis View in CoL – Kaufman 1996: 1.

Material examined

Lectotype TANZANIA • Korogwe ; 1888; F. Stuhlmann leg.; ZMH, ZMH402 View Materials .

Paralectotypes TANZANIA • 3 individuals; Korogwe; 1888; F. Stuhlmann leg.; ZMH403 1–3 1 individual; Korogwe ; 1888; F. Stuhlmann leg.; BMNH 1899.2.27.1 .

Additional material

TANZANIA – Ruvu River (between Lake Jipe and Nyumba ya Mungu Reservoir) 3 specimens; 14 Aug. 2015; M. Genner, A. Shechonge, A. Smith and B.P. Ngatunga leg.; BMNH 2021.7.15.1 BMNH 2021.7.15.3 .

Distribution

Pangani River system, specimens only known from the Korogwe, Nyumba ya Mungu Reservoir, and the Ruvu River (between Lake Jipe and Nyumba ya Mungu Reservoir).
